We review the construction and properties of four dimensional string models, using free fermions on the world-sheet. We prove that as opposed to gauge symmetries, broken space-time supersymmetry can only be restored continuously by decompactification.

The standard model of particle physics is analyzed for the case of a Higgs potential not favoring spontaneous electroweak symmetry breaking to gain insight into the physics of the standard model. Electroweak breaking still takes place, and quarks and leptons still acquire masses but through bosonic technicolor. This " other " phase of the standard model exhibits interesting phenomena.

The status of internal symmetry breaking at high temperature in supersymmetric models is reviewed. This phenomenon could solve some well known cosmological problems, such as the domain wall, monopole and false vacuum problems.
